Amteshwar Singh is a scholar working on Epidemiology, Infectious Diseases and General Health Professions. According to data from OpenAlex, Amteshwar Singh has authored 20 papers receiving a total of 255 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 5 papers in Epidemiology, 5 papers in Infectious Diseases and 4 papers in General Health Professions. Recurrent topics in Amteshwar Singh’s work include COVID-19 and healthcare impacts (3 papers), Emergency and Acute Care Studies (2 papers) and Healthcare professionals’ stress and burnout (2 papers). Amteshwar Singh is often cited by papers focused on COVID-19 and healthcare impacts (3 papers), Emergency and Acute Care Studies (2 papers) and Healthcare professionals’ stress and burnout (2 papers). Amteshwar Singh collaborates with scholars based in United States, India and Australia. Amteshwar Singh's co-authors include Rahul Chaudhary, M Novakovic, Vipin Kumar Verma, Thomas C. Kingsley, Amit Rout, Ravi Kant, Shaker M. Eid, Henry J. Michtalik, Mansoor Malik and Sonal Gandhi and has published in prestigious journals such as CHEST Journal, The American Journal of Medicine and Journal of the American Geriatrics Society.
